Galaxy Tab A8 has a general score of 62.6, which is much better than Motorola XOOM's general score of 55.9. Both of these tablets use Android OS (Operating System), but the Galaxy Tab A8 has 11 version and Motorola XOOM has Android 4.0. The Galaxy Tab A8 is a much newer device, and it is also incredibly lighter and a lot thinner than Motorola XOOM.
The Motorola XOOM counts with a slightly better looking screen than Galaxy Tab A8, although it has a lot lower resolution of 800 x 1280 pixels, a lot lower quantity of pixels per display inch and a quite smaller screen. The Samsung Galaxy Tab A8 counts with a much bigger memory capacity to store more games and applications than Motorola XOOM, and although they both have the same internal storage capacity, the Samsung Galaxy Tab A8 also has a SD card slot that allows a maximum of 1 TB.
Motorola XOOM has a much faster processor than Samsung Galaxy Tab A8, although it has 6 lesser processing cores and a lower amount of RAM memory. Motorola XOOM counts with a slightly better camera than Galaxy Tab A8, although it has a lot less mega pixels resolution back camera. Galaxy Tab A8 features a very superior battery duration than Motorola XOOM.
